Demonstrating the feasibility of safe, reliable and sustainable nuclear systems by developing - by 2026 - the first electrical simulator of a liquid-lead cooled reactor is the goal pursued by ENEA and newcleo at the ENEA Research Center in Brasimone (Bologna), an international center of excellence for the development of liquid metal technologies.
An identitification card to provide proof of quality and traceability of coffee - one of the world's most widely consumed products - is the outcome of a collaboration between ENEA, the company Pnat (a spin-off of the University of Florence), the Accademia del Caffè Espresso (La Marzocco) and the coffee regulatory bodies of eight countries in Central and South America. The goal is to achieve traceability of premium quality coffee (specialty coffee) and improve the livelihoods of smallholder coffee farmers whom often are the main producers of specialty coffees.

Accelerating technology transfer to companies in the CSP sector -concentrated solar power plants- using molten salts is the objective of the EU project EuroPaTMoS, comprising seven partners from four European countries, including ENEA. The transnational nature of the project makes it possible to create a stable connection for future joint research and development actions in this sector among Germany, Spain, Portugal and Italy, in which the ENEA Casaccia Research Center (Rome) acts as a point of reference for national research activities.
A research team from twelve European scientific institutions has begun the fourth and decisive drilling campaign of the Beyond EPICA - Oldest Ice project at the Little Dome C camp, located 35 kilometers from Italian-French Concordia Station, in Antarctica. This international endeavor, led by the Institute of Polar Sciences of the National Research Council (Cnr-Isp), aims to drill from the depth reached last season, 1,836 meters, down to 2,750 meters, where the bedrock is expected to be found. Ice at this depth could hold records of Earth’s climate history dating back as far as 1.5 million years, revealing, for the first time, direct information on atmospheric temperature and greenhouse gas concentrations over such an extended period.
